Police have confirmed which railway service an incident that saw a number of people stabbed on a train in Cambridgeshire took place on on Saturday evening.
Emergency services were called after a number of people were stabbed near Huntingdon.
British Transport Police said the train involved was the 6.25pm service from Doncaster to London King’s Cross.
The force said a full update will follow shortly.
LIVE: 'Multiple people' stabbed on LNER train - updates
Two people have been arrested following the incident.
A man who was travelling on the train has said he saw an “extremely bloodied” victim and that he believes a suspect was tasered.
